The quantum information group at the University of British Columbia has an opening for a Research Associate position in quantum information and related condensed matter physics. The successful candidate will perform research in the area of classical simulation of quantum systems. A profound knowledge of the theory of entanglement and of classical simulation methods based on tensor networks is expected, as well as a strong record of previous achievement in research. Applicants must have a PhD in Physics, and should have previous postdoctoral experience. Candidates should submit a CV including a list of publications, three representative papers, and the names of three references electronically by March 30, 2010 to Prof. Robert Raussendorf (email: raussen=AT=phas.ubc.ca )
Review of applications will begin on March 30, 2010 and continue until the position is filled. The initial appointment will be for a period of 18 months and is expected to begin April 15, 2010, with further reappointments dependent on budget and performance.
Salary will be competitive, and commensurate with experience. UBC hires on the basis of merit and is committed to employment equity. All qualified persons are encouraged to apply. UBC is strongly committed to diversity within its community and especially welcomes applications from visible minority group members, women, Aboriginal persons, persons with disabilities, persons of any sexual orientation or gender identity, and others who may contribute to the further diversification of ideas. Canadians and permanent residents of Canada will be given priority.
